Analysis of Gold Prices and Market Sentiment

On Tuesday, gold prices saw a slight increase of 0.30% due to the decline in US Treasury yields and the weakening of the US dollar. The market is currently holding its breath as traders await important US inflation data, as well as the first presidential debate between Kamala Harris and Donald Trump. These upcoming events have the potential to greatly influence the market’s mood and direction.

Gold (XAUUSD) is currently trading at $2,514, after recovering from a low of $2,500. The likelihood of a Federal Reserve interest rate cut is high, with a 67% chance of a 25 basis point reduction and a 33% probability of a 50 basis point cut. Recent US job data showed fewer new jobs created than expected, but the unemployment rate did see a slight decrease, providing some relief to the Federal Reserve.

Looking at the charts, it is evident that gold did see a bounce from the trendline support, mainly due to the confluence of the daily timeframe pivot and hidden divergence on the stochastic indicator. However, the current price action suggests that gold is now consolidating around another daily timeframe pivot, indicating a potential reversal in the near future. This presents an opportunity for bears to enter the market, especially if there is a break-and-retest of the trendline support.

On the 1-hour timeframe, gold prices appear to be forming a SBR (Support, Break, Retest) pattern, which could be confirmed after a rejection from the supply zone above inducement. Overall, the sentiment in the market remains bearish, with analysts expecting a downward movement towards a target of $2,495.75. This bearish outlook would be invalidated if gold prices were to rise above $2,530.15.
